GF is the one Disney resort I've seen that could probably happily exist without WDW...after all,it was designed after a real resort. One could really unwind in a few days there. Contemporary is old and cold...my idea of what it would be like to live in a subway station. The theme may have seemed clever when it was built but has become very dated as years go by. Polynesian is also a nice choice but most of the comnments I see on the boards seem to indicate that the restaurants are the attraction rather than the resort itself.
 
I agree that GF is not too formal. When I first stayed in the main building I was worried about having to walk through the Lobby to go to the pool -- but you don't have to. There is a back elevator to a door right near the pools.

When not in pool clothes, the Lobby is fantastic. The flowers etc. are spectacular.

Only relative negative from my experience is that the service is not at the same level with the physical facilities and amenities. I have consitently waited longer for bell/valet service at GF than at any other Deluxe.
